Output 3f8debe760df07f4a5a2ae93f1ba35e61d5c181059261e418133578c56cb4d55:0

value
90965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ba4bfab07d2bd8285cc2a5ceb47acbf39e81dafd OP_EQUAL
address
3Jg4dMZw5eFQqJhGhGkRo8Yjhskgb4bSKi
transaction
3f8debe760df07f4a5a2ae93f1ba35e61d5c181059261e418133578c56cb4d55
spent
true